System Overview

The AWD system on the Lexus RX 350 works by transferring power from the engine to all four wheels simultaneously. This helps improve traction, as well as providing a smoother ride. The AWD system can be either full-time or part-time. The full-time system means that power is always being sent to all four wheels, while in a part-time system, power is sent only when needed or when certain conditions require it.

Troubleshooting Trac Off On Lexus RX 350

If your vehicle has Trac Off enabled but you are still experiencing wheel slip or excessive spin due to road conditions or other factors, there could be an issue with your Lexus RX 350’s AWD system that needs addressing. First check that your tires are properly inflated and rotate them if necessary. If this does not solve the issue you may need to check your vehicle’s differential fluid levels and inspect for any signs of wear or damage such as leaking seals or worn bearings. You should also inspect any wiring harnesses connected to your differential for any signs of corrosion or damage which could be causing issues with power delivery from one wheel to another.

Diagnosing Problems With The AWD System

When diagnosing problems with your Lexus RX 350’s AWD system there are several things you should look out for: abnormal tire wear; leaking fluid; rattling noises when turning; slipping gears; sluggish acceleration; vibrations while driving; and decreased fuel efficiency due abnormal torque distribution between wheels caused by faulty components within the differential housing assembly including axle shafts, bearing assemblies and differential gears .

Common Fixes For Problems With The AWD System

Depending on what kind of problem you are experiencing with your Lexus RX 350s AWD system there are several possible fixes: replacing worn components such as axle shafts; repairing damaged wiring harnesses; replacing broken seals; changing fluids if necessary; adjusting air pressures if needed; recalibrating sensors if necessary ; replacing clogged filters ;and replacing faulty solenoids .
